"Elders: Guardians of Wisdom, Keepers of Tradition" In the timeless play "Antigone, " the chorus stands as a symbol of wisdom and experience, offering guidance in times of moral dilemma. Similarly, Artemisia Gentileschi's painting "Susannah and the Elders" portrays their role as protectors against injustice. From Omani elders proudly donning Khanjar and carrying rifles to Western Australia's Aborigine Elders preparing for a Corroboree, these esteemed individuals embody cultural heritage and ancestral knowledge. Their presence is a testament to the resilience and strength that comes with age. Religious art also pays homage to elders' significance. In "Jesus Among the Doctors, " we witness Jesus engaging in profound discussions with wise sages, highlighting their respected position within society. Tapestry covers depicting scenes such as "The Stoning of Elders" or "The Elders before Daniel" further emphasize their authority throughout history. However, not all references to they can positive. The infamous document known as PROTOCOL / ELDERS OF ZION falsely portrays them in a negative light, perpetuating harmful stereotypes and conspiracy theories. Nevertheless, Bulgarian Peasants Dance celebrates the joyous spirit found among older generations who continue to embrace life through dance and celebration. It reminds us that age should never hinder one's ability to find happiness or express themselves fully. Whether they appear on tapestries from Sheldon or participate in ancient rituals like Corroboree ceremonies, elders hold an essential place within our societies worldwide. They serve as beacons of wisdom whose stories connect past generations with future ones - bridging gaps between cultures while preserving invaluable traditions for posterity.
